Output 987879166513af259513244bda56e7caf6e4d00e4475f720be630ab10fc6073a:0

value
10967786
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45a742132868de5c059e78e0e7464a593d7155fc OP_EQUALVERIFY OP_CHECKSIG
address
17MHzXvYNxtWsTxzDRyDSTNrKFRg8QVwqz
transaction
987879166513af259513244bda56e7caf6e4d00e4475f720be630ab10fc6073a